Farren, Sean – Language, Culture and Curriculum, 1992
Recent proposals to make Knowledge about Language (KAL) an integral part of the teaching of English in Britain and Northern Ireland are discussed. The KAL debate is traced from the 1975 Bullock Report, which ended the teaching of traditional grammar, through the lack of progress to the present day. (Contains 19 references.) (Author/LB)
